The Gaza Bakery Owners Association has criticized the UN World Food Program’s (WFP) new bread distribution system as “unjust,” asserting it does not meet the basic needs of Palestinians amid flour shortages and bakery closures. Chairman Abdel Nasser Al-Ajrami emphasized that the WFP’s approach forces bakeries to operate with limited resources, failing to address the urgent food crisis, and suggested an alternative distribution of flour bags to families, which the WFP rejected. With Gaza under a full blockade and facing imminent famine, UN officials have warned of the dire humanitarian situation exacerbated by ongoing military actions.

March for Gaza activists 'abducted, beaten' by Egyptian guards in CairoActivists participating in a march for Gaza reported being abducted and beaten by Egyptian guards in Cairo. Egypt's foreign ministry had previously mandated that travel to the Rafah area requires prior approval for safety, which organizers claim they sought to obtain through official channels.
